Indicators You Ought to Think About Animal Removal Services
Spotting the signs that suggest a requirement for animal removal services is vital for upholding a safe home setting. Homeowners should stay vigilant for unexpected noises in attics or walls, which may indicate the occurrence of pests. In addition, unforeseen damage to property, such as gnawed wires or chewed furniture, can be a clear indication of an animal infestation.
Locating excrement or trails near the residence is another sign that professional assistance might be necessary. Unpleasant odors, often caused by animal waste or dead animals, can also point to a serious concern. Furthermore, views of wildlife in or around the property, especially during the light hours, may show that animals are encroaching on living spaces. Prompt attention to these signs can prevent more significant problems and ensure the safety and comfort of the household. How to Prevent Forthcoming Wild animal Problems
Preventing future wildlife concerns requires preventative measures and a keen eye for likely entry paths. Homeowners should often inspect their properties for gaps in foundations, attics, and vents, sealing any openings to deter animal intrusion. Proper maintenance of landscaping is vital; dense vegetation can provide protection for pests. Additionally, securely storing food and garbage in animal-proof containers minimizes attraction to wildlife.
Installing barriers can also serve as a warning, especially around vegetable patches or livestock areas. It is crucial to keep outdoor spaces clean by eliminating waste and mess that may shelter animals. Educating family members about animal consciousness and the importance of documenting encounters can promote a preventative mindset. Ultimately, consistent vigilance and maintenance of the premises create an inhospitable space for wildlife, greatly reducing the probability of future infestations and guaranteeing peace of mind for homeowners.
